    2 things:

    1 to filter your contacts (get rid of facebook, gmail contacts etc) contacts>menu (bottom left button)>display group>phone contacts. This will show only the contacts that you actually call while still being synched with facebook, etc

    2 In the contacts screen, at the very top are the numbers for #bal, #min, #Warranty center, etc. If you want them to go away, tap on it>menu>edit (i got rid of the pound sign and put a z in front) or just tap delete. This makes it less cluttered :-)

    ok tip and question.

    Swype Tip: When you have a text input screen, tap and hold the text box (where any typed data would go)and eventually a box comes up that gives you the choice of input method. You can use the standard keyboard, swype, or any custom keyboard you may have installed.

    Text message question: When I use my volume rocker to change the ring status to vibrate, the text message goes to silent. I only know a text came in if I see the blinking light. How do I make the phone vibrate for a received text when the ringer is set to vibrate? Also can the phone screen be set to turn on briefly when a text comes in while the phone is on vibrate, just like if it were to ring?
    Genius!!! i couldnt figure out how to go back from teh swype to the normal keyboard...i figured out also holding down the "settings icon/#s and symbols" button on the keyboard..(far bottom left buttom) also allows you to go to input method and method settings..but i hate that swype keyboard so much, its pointless and doesnt allow 2 hand typing at all, so i could never figure out how to quickly change back to the normal way.

    Also..ive noticed if you HOLD the camera button teh camera turns on..ive read alot of reviews from boy genius and engadget that made complaints about how the button doesnt load up teh camera when pressed. dont think they are holdinig it down.

    People who like to browse the web..i highly recommend dumping the stock browser, and picking up Dolphin HD, and the backup bookmarks to SD add-on app, the direct mobile - desktop toggle add on, and the screen capture add on...they work wonders!

    And WI-FI, ive been reading, you need to set security to wpa2-psk and change to channel 11, and modes b & g only, or you can just turn security off if your in a trusting area. But i cant get it to connect via WEP. Make sure to reboot all network devices after this too for it to fully function.
